Oualidia is a hidden gem on Morocco’s Atlantic coast, offering tranquil lagoon waters, fresh seafood, and unspoiled natural beauty. This charming seaside village is nestled between El Jadida and Safi, about two hours from Marrakech and Casablanca. Known for its stunning crescent-shaped lagoon protected by a natural sandbar, Oualidia is one of the country’s most peaceful coastal escapes. Its calm, shallow waters are ideal for swimming, kayaking, and paddleboarding, while the Atlantic waves just beyond the lagoon attract keen surfers.

A laid-back destination defined by its connection to the sea, Oualidia is perfect for couples, families, and nature lovers seeking a slower pace of life. It is especially famous for its oyster farms, producing some of the finest oysters in Morocco, best enjoyed at the simple waterfront restaurants overlooking the lagoon. Birdwatchers are also drawn here, as the lagoon is an important stop for migrating flamingos and other exotic species.

Unlike Morocco’s larger beach resorts, Oualidia remains authentic and understated, offering boutique guesthouses, scenic coastal walks, and breathtaking sunsets over the ocean.
